Theosis

Beyond Psikinetics and the straightforwardness of mono-hypostatic mortal Souls expressing a single ousia is the power of Theosis.   Theosis is a spiritual ousia distinct from the psikinetic vita field, and its hypostasis (or expression) is only found in beings linked to the Creator of The Cosmos. Historically, this was only the Nadrakians as they were the only life directly brought into existence by the Creator. However other individuals and races were able to acquire Theosis from time to time through various means.   The ousia of Theosis obeys different rules from the ousia of The Vita Field and its psikinetics, and doesn’t operate within the sandbox defined by the laws of physics. It can act beyond those rules, and entirely supersede and overwrite them. It’s therefore understood as being capable of carrying out miracles, known as Charisms.   Beings that express this ousia necessarily also express the vita field ousia too (in the form of intellect and psikinetics) by virtue of being alive and possessing a soul, and are hence profoundly gifted spiritually from this hypostatic union. The difference isn't merely quantitative but also qualitative, and manifests as an insurmountable difference in ability and nature. This is why Nadrakians, Rodinians and similar beings are considered inviolate.   As well as being a source of spiritual power, it’s also viewed as a process by both Rodinians and Nadrakians whereby one can increase the depth of their Theosis through greater adherence to the governing doctrine of the Creator.  

Ousia, Hypostasis and Hypostatic Unions

  An ousia is a source of spiritual action with a distinct nature of its own that can’t be reformulated as a product or sum of any other source of spiritual action. It’s therefore fundamental. The vita field is considered to be an ousia, and the native source of spiritual power in this universe. It’s often regarded as the source of mortal souls, and the mortal power of psikinetics. The divine ousia is another distinct spiritual source derived from the Creator of the cosmos, and gives rise to the power of Theosis. As it's accepted as being external to our universe, and in some sense even involved in its creation, it's understood as being capable of superseding the laws of physics in our universe. A further ousia also exists, called Iconoclasm, which is discussed in a later article.   Souls can be composed of one or more of these ousia, and an expression or presence of an ousia within a soul is known as a hypostasis.   Most mortals who possess only souls of the vita field ousia are known as monohypostatic souls. Nadrakians and those born of their pairing with a mortal are hetero-ousian, and therefore dihypostatic. They house within them two distinct hypostases operating as one entity/soul, which is a state known as hypostatic union. Souls existing in a state of hypostatic union of two or more ousia are geometrically more powerful spiritually, both quantitatively and qualitatively. Rodinians and Ninth Caste Nadrakians are so far the only known beings to possess trihypostatic souls, giving rise to their great power.   An ousia can have multiple hypostases, and therefore ousia and hypostasis are not synonymous. This is commonly seen in the vita field with the development of compound, collective consciousness from all the life on a planet. Intelligent beings from that planet will possess their own soul, as one hypostasis of the vita field. However, as their soul is embedded within a planetary aura, when that aura finally becomes self-aware (such as in the case of the Earth), their soul will obtain a second hypostasis of the vita field – that which is instilled from the collective consciousness of all life from their home planet.   The Rodinians possess this dual-hypostasis of the vita field, and it's been put forward as one of the reasons why their power fluctuates over time (and is currently lower than when they defeated Archnadrakian Balaine). Balancing the hypostasis of their own ego with that of the Earth’s, whilst also following the Praxis of Theosis, is difficult. If these hypostases are not all satisfied spiritually, then it’s believed they interfere with each other. The notion of Hypostatic Coherence is covered in more detail below.    

Origins and Prerequisites of Theosis

  When the Creator breathed life into Archnadrakian Balaine, it conferred into Balaine its divine nature, or ousia. This ousia was an entirely distinct source of spiritual action and power from the vita field that mortal souls and their psikinetics come from, and was passed into the Nadrakians that Balaine himself would create from his own flesh, blood and soul.   For almost all of their recorded history, Nadrakians were the only source of this ousia in the universe. From time to time, a Nadrakian would reproduce with a mortal and the result of this pairing would produce a bloodline that could temporarily express this ousia and achieve Theosis to some extent, until it faded through generations of dilution. These progenies would be semi-divine like the Nadrakians, and their souls would possess hypostases of both the vita field and Theosis.   During the Blood Harvest, the Nadrakians gifted many civilisations the divine ousia of Theosis to help them resist the fallen Archnadrakian Balaine and its Ninth Caste. This was the only other way in which Theosis could be obtained. Following the Blood Harvest, the Rodinians were the sole surviving civilisation to have received the divine ousia, which by virtue of all Rodinians possessing it via the soul of the Earth itself being made partially divine, does not dilute over time. This gave rise to the power of Theosis for Rodinians in perpetuity.   There's one other requirement for receiving the gifts and power of Theosis, and that’s the fundamental spiritual power of the soul. The divine ousia requires a soul of considerable power to awaken its hypostasis and retain this awakened state. The Nadrakians only gifted it to certain civilisations possessing sufficiently developed souls capable of using it. The threshold is about half of the spiritual dyne density of the Earth and its creatures’ souls, as they were three million years ago during the The Siege of Rodinia.    

The Praxis of Theosis

  Praxis, the notion of putting into practice a theory or principle, is central to Theosis. Theosis doesn’t just describe a source of spiritual action or ousia. It’s also a process by which one can increase their understanding of that source, and thereby increase the degree to which it responds to them.   The ousia of Theosis is inextricably tied to the High Commandment of the Creator that dictated the Nadrakian’s actions throughout the cosmos. This commandment is written:  Act to ensure the ever increasing complexity and diversity of life in our cosmos, and the elimination of life's suffering.  The Nadrakians believed close observation and adherence to this principle was central to their power, and the process of Theosis depended upon it. They created a system of benevolence, stewardship, guidance, and compassion for living things, as these were observed to steadily progress them closer along the path towards complete Theosis.   For the Rodinians, they too are bound by this creed as they possess the same ousia within their souls. For Rodinians however it’s far more complicated due to the hypostasis of the Earth’s soul, as well as the presence of the Iconoclastic ousia too.   Earth is the ultimate authority in the sphere of life that traces its origin to the planet, and it exerts an influence upon the souls of the Rodinians. The Earth’s own wishes form a separate creed tied to the Earth’s hypostasis within each Rodinian soul. The creed of the Earth is generally understood to be actions that increase the presence of the Earth’s life throughout the universe, and therefore the power of Earth’s soul. Rodinians aligning closely to this creed are believed to experience greater baseline psikinetics than those who don't.   However, the current creed of the Earth is also believed to be in opposition to that of the Creator (as increasing the prevalence of the Earth’s biosphere will detract from other biospheres, decreasing overall diversity of life), and hence total observation of one creed and fulfilment of one hypostasis will detract from the other. This is what’s known as the Earth-Theosis Paradox in Rodinian theological circles, and attempts at resolving it are a major source of spiritual activity with many different sects and religions existing each with different philosophies and approaches. Its resolution is believed to lead to a state called Hypostatic Coherence, where all the hypostases within the soul are in perfect agreement with each other, and complement each other fully rather than interfering with each other.   The Rodinians who defeated Archnadrakian Balaine three million years ago were believed to have existed in a state of near hypostatic coherence between the wishes of the Earth and the wishes of the Creator, as defeating Balaine and the Ninth Caste was exactly in line with those two creeds. In that moment, Rodinians temporarily achieved near perfect Theosis.   Since then, however, they've slipped away from it. Their increasingly isolationist inward thinking and abandonment of the cosmos to decline and savagery has led them further from the creed of the Creator and further from Theosis. At the same time, they're now also in opposition to the Earth’s wishes of spreading her life throughout the universe. This is believed to have produced a marked drop-off in their power since old times.   However, given that even in this weakened state they still vastly outstrip everyone else’s highest possible ceiling of power and ability (in any regard), there's been little to no backlash about the political changes that invited this decline.

Limits of Theosis

  Theosis can negate the costs of performing any action, except costs that would be impossible for the soul or person to pay otherwise. In other words it can't bypass fundamental limitations the soul may have.   For example it could negate the cost of a Rodinian lifting a starship, as this is something a Rodinian can easily accomplish anyway. In this case, Theosis is allowing the Rodinian to do something they can already do, but with no exertion upon their soul and no psikinetics used. This frees up their soul to do other things with their psikinetic/Miro budget. It also means they don't need to calculate the psikinetics required. A Rodinian who isn't trained as a healer could nevertheless "will" another Rodinian rapidly back to full health, as they could in theory learn this skill with enough time. There's no fundamental reason they can't do it.   That same Rodinian cannot gravitationally unbind a star in one second however, because their soul would ordinarily be incapable of generating so much energy. This is a cost the power of Theosis within them cannot erase, and is therefore a level of miracle they cannot perform. Only by increased praxis can they raise the fundamental limitations on their soul, as this grows the power of the Theosis ousia within them and therefore grows their soul, making it intrinsically more capable. This is also the only way the range of their soul's spiritual powers can be increased too, as this is another fundamental limitation Theosis can't overcome – it can't act outside the soul's range of effect.

Geometric Spiritual Scaling

  The power of a soul possessing more than one ousia (all beings who possess Theosis, in other words) will scale with the square of their dyne. This means the power and precision of any psikinetics are increased by the square of their original pre-Theosis power. The addition of a second hypostasis of a different ousia is therefore a geometric increase and not merely additive. This is why Nadrakians and Rodinians are so much more powerful than anyone else.   For example, if a monohypostatic soul could lift 10 kg with telekinesis before being imbued with the Theosis ousia, then afterwards it'll be able to lift not 20 kg, but 100 kg. If they could lift 100 kg before, then they’d be able to life 10’000 kg now. They are at this point a dihypostatic soul.    

Primacy

  Another reality of hetero-ousian souls is the concept of primacy. Souls of one hypostasis from one ousia only (homo-ousian) cannot interfere with or override hetero-ousian souls. They're instead completely overruled.   This concept can be likened to dimensionality. Mortal souls of the vita field only possess a single spiritual dimension (ousia). Dihypostatic souls from different ousia however possess two orthogonal spiritual dimensions representing the two different ousia. This makes the souls with Theosis planar in nature, whilst mortal souls are simply linear. Most of the planar dihypostatic soul therefore exists across a spiritual dimension inaccessible to the monohypostatic mortal soul, making the mechanisms by which that higher soul operates also beyond its reach (such as the higher soul’s psikinetics). The linear mortal soul can also be entirely viewed and accessed by the planar dihypostatic soul, making the mechanisms of the lower soul easy to view, understand and interfere with.   Primacy is what makes Nadrakian and Rodinian psikinetics totally unbeatable. They aren’t just orders of magnitude stronger and more precise. They are intrinsically always going to win, even if on paper they were somehow outclassed in raw power and precision alone. When a Rodinian or Nadrakian body is assaulted by the psikinetic output of a monohypostatic soul, the psikinetic reinforcement of the bonds in their bodies simply flat out reject those psikinetics. Likewise, Nadrakians and Rodinians dismantle the psikinetics of others with minimal effort no matter how much power or thought has been put into crafting them. It's as though no one else in the universe actually has psikinetics at all.   When the Rodinians received the power of Theosis during the Blood Harvest, they became dihypostatic souls on the same level as the original Nadrakians, and hence could interact with their psikinetics. They were as yet unable to fight back against the Ninth Caste Nadrakians however until they later awakened the ousia of Iconoclasm, as the Ninth Caste possessed trihypostatic souls. Trihypostatic souls are superior in primacy to both mono- and dihypostatic souls.   A dihypostatic soul can still create psikinetics with monohypostatic properties if they wish, but the reverse can never happen.

Symmetry Violations

  Even with psikinetics, certain quantities like energy, momentum, angular momentum, etc need to be conserved. To melt something by increasing molecular and atomic vibrations using psikinetics, you must first source the extra energy from somewhere else. Then, you move this energy from that location into the target to melt, via your soul as the channelling conduit.   If you wish to move something using telekinesis, then momentum needs to be conserved too. If you lift a cup, then the required reaction force from lifting the cup against the force of gravity needs to be delivered into something else, such as the ground. Your soul, again, acts as the channeling conduit linking both objects (cup and ground) together, and through which the momentum (and also energy) shall flow.   This isn't the case with Theosis. Energy can be created from seemingly nothing, violating the conservation of energy. When this intersects with psikinetics, the user no longer needs to obtain energy from somewhere else to, for example, move an object with telekinesis or excite a quantum field to create particles of one kind (such as photons for light or heat). They can create it from nothing within whatever system they're influencing.   The energy seems to come from within the soul itself, to be imbued into the system being altered. As the soul must still channel and deliver this energy, the same rules apply regarding potential psikinetic burn-out, where the soul can only handle a specific quantity of energy before suffering too much damage to its nimata. The cost upon the soul for using Symmetry Violation seems to be twice as great however, which is understood as the cost of creating the energy from nothing, plus the cost of then moving it into the target system. Burn-out therefore occurs twice as quick if over-exerting using Symmetry Violation.   Symmetry violation is specifically called upon and activated, usually when a Rodinian, Nadrakian or other being with Theosis, requires more energy than what's otherwise available to them in the environment.

Remote Viewing

  Remote Viewing is the power to observe events completely outside the range of the physical senses, unimpeded by physical distance or barriers. It’s one of the four powers of clairvoyance in Theosis, the other three being Precognition, Retrocognition and Altercognition. Remote Viewing deals with remote events outside the range of the senses occurring in the present, whereas the other powers observe events through time.   A soul capable of this power can potentially (but not with guaranteed certainty) know all events within its aura. Some Rodinians with auras falling across a planet, who were able to remote view, were practically omniscient with respect to all events on that planet.    

Precognition

  The second of the clairvoyant powers sees events occurring in the future, and is believed to be a result of divine souls having the ability to move through time as well as space.   Precognition obeys some of the rules of future time travel in the sense that it accesses events occurring within the most probable sequence of future events (In otherwords, the future as it currently stands). It doesn’t however need to obey the rules regarding changing the future. Precognitive beings can change the future without running into the paradoxes that ordinary time travelers run into.    

Retrocognition

  The third clairvoyant power is obtaining knowledge of past events without having witness it. Those with the power of retrocognition have a greater ability to change the past. Ordinarily, one cannot change the past deliberately, as this would prevent you in future from knowing about the event you would like to change/have changed, thereby stopping you from going back in time in the first place.   Retrocognate knowledge is not subject to this limitation, and so can change the past without their knowledge of the event being affected. This is true only so long as the change they are making doesn’t materially impact themselves however.    

Altercognition

  The final clairvoyant ability is the power to know about events that can also happen as a result of different past, present and future actions. It allows one to peer into other timelines to see how the future might progress, or how different the present might be, given different past choices made. It’s therefore a wider ranging power than the other three in how it includes other possibilities in its sight.
